AS A BOOST to its plan of extending natural gas infrastructure beyond Lagos to other parts of Nigeria, Oando Gas and Power has secured the Right of Way (ROW)

approval from the Akwa Ibom State Government for the construction of its 128 km South East gas pipeline project from Ukanafun in the state to Mfamosing, Cross Rivers State. The ROW within the Akwa Ibom state boundary is approximately 80 km out of the total 128 km for the project.

Already, East Horizon Gas Company, Oando’s subsidiary of Oando handling the project, has achieved over 15 km of pipeline construction within the Cross River state boundary, and now Oando is set to commence construction activities in Akwa Ibom State in time for the planned year end project delivery target. Commenting on the ROW approval, Mr. Bolaji Osunsanya, CEO of Oando Gas and Power, said, "We are very pleased with the Akwa Ibom ROW approval as it now positions us to meet our target to delivering gas to United Cement Company (UNICEM) and other customers by year end." This project will connect to the existing Obigbo-ALSCON line at Ukanafun Local Government of Akwa Ibom State and will run about 128 km through Akwa Ibom and Cross River States.

The pipeline project will involve major civil engineering works as it crosses eight major rivers and some swamp locations before terminating at the new United Cement Company factory (UNICEM), located at Mfamosing, near Calabar.
